What is your routine like?

I usually start my day very early and dedicate the wee hours for meditation which helps me to keep my mind calm and focused all day. I make sure to spend some quality time with my children. I wake them up, exercise with them, and also help them get ready for their online school. I have a very light breakfast which includes fresh fruits, soaked dry fruits, and a cup of cold-pressed vegetable juice. My lunch consists of a small portion of saute vegetables and a sprout meal. The outline of my diet is a healthy breakfast and lunch with no dinner. Also, both my meals consist of living vegan food. I prefer to sleep early. Meditation and a low diet allow me to have 4-5 hours of sleep and still be energetic throughout the day. Every Tuesday I do complete fasting and I never skip my workout and yoga. Even when I am traveling I try to maintain my routine.
